Business Process Automation
Business process automation (BPA) is the technology-enabled automation of complex business processes.
BPA can improve efficiency, accuracy, and compliance, and can free up employees to focus on more strategic tasks.
There are many different types of BPA tools available, and the best tool for a particular process will depend on the specific requirements of the process, such as the complexity, the volume of transactions, and the need for integration with other systems.
BPA can be used to automate a wide variety of business processes, including:
- Order processing
- Invoice processing
- Customer service
- Human resources
- Financial management
- Supply chain management
BPA can be a valuable tool for businesses of all sizes. By automating repetitive and time-consuming tasks, BPA can help businesses improve efficiency and productivity.

Careers in Business Process Automation
There are a variety of careers available in business process automation, including:
- Business process analyst: Business process analysts identify and analyze business processes to identify areas for improvement.
- BPA consultant: BPA consultants help businesses to implement and manage BPA solutions.
- Software developer: Software developers develop and maintain BPA software.
- Project manager: Project managers oversee BPA projects.
- Quality assurance analyst: Quality assurance analysts test and validate BPA solutions.
